In the ever-evolving digital landscape, ensuring that web applications function seamlessly across different devices, browsers, and operating systems has become more crucial than ever. This is where the Certificate in Web Application Compatibility Testing comes into play—a specialized certification that equips professionals with the skills needed to test for compatibility in a dynamic and diverse technological ecosystem. In this blog post, we’ll delve into the latest trends, innovations, and future developments in web application compatibility testing, providing you with a comprehensive understanding of how to stay ahead in this rapidly changing field.
The Shift Towards Automation and AI
One of the most significant trends in web application compatibility testing is the increasing reliance on automation and artificial intelligence (AI). Traditional manual testing methods are time-consuming and can be prone to human error. Automation tools, such as Selenium, Katalon, and TestComplete, offer a more efficient and scalable alternative. These tools can run tests across multiple browsers and devices simultaneously, providing consistent and accurate results. Moreover, AI-driven tools can predict potential compatibility issues based on historical data, thereby helping testers proactively address problems before they impact users.
Embracing Cloud-Based Testing Environments
The cloud has revolutionized the way we approach web application testing. Cloud-based testing environments offer several advantages, including cost savings, flexibility, and the ability to scale resources as needed. Cloud platforms like AWS, Azure, and Google Cloud provide robust testing environments that can simulate various real-world scenarios, from different geographical locations to varying network conditions. This flexibility enables testers to perform comprehensive compatibility testing without the need for expensive and specialized hardware. As cloud technology continues to evolve, it is expected to play an increasingly pivotal role in web application compatibility testing.
The Importance of Continuous Integration and Continuous Deployment (CI/CD)
In today’s fast-paced development environment, Continuous Integration and Continuous Deployment (CI/CD) have become essential practices for software development teams. CI/CD pipelines automate the testing process, ensuring that every code change is thoroughly tested before integrating it into the main codebase. For web application compatibility testing, integrating these pipelines can drastically reduce the time it takes to detect and fix compatibility issues. By automating the testing process, teams can ensure that their applications remain compatible with a wide range of environments while maintaining a high level of quality and performance.
Future Developments and Emerging Technologies
Looking ahead, several emerging technologies are poised to transform the landscape of web application compatibility testing. One such technology is the Internet of Things (IoT), which is expected to increase the complexity of web applications by introducing new devices and platforms. Another trend is the rise of virtual and augmented reality (VR/AR), which will require robust testing frameworks to ensure compatibility across various devices and platforms. Additionally, the adoption of containerization and serverless architectures will necessitate new testing methodologies to ensure that web applications can seamlessly run in these environments.
Conclusion
The Certificate in Web Application Compatibility Testing is more relevant than ever in today’s interconnected digital world. By staying informed about the latest trends, innovations, and future developments in this field, professionals can ensure that their web applications are robust, reliable, and compatible across a wide range of environments. Embracing automation, leveraging cloud-based testing environments, and integrating CI/CD pipelines are just a few ways to stay ahead in this competitive space. As the digital landscape continues to evolve, the demand for skilled compatibility testers will only grow, making this certification a valuable asset in your professional toolkit.
By staying attuned to these developments and continually refining your skills, you can not only enhance the user experience but also contribute to the ongoing evolution of web application compatibility testing.